Lines Matching refs:HAT_ISMBUSY
8311 ASSERT(S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Y));
10866 * use HAT_ISMBUSY flag (protected by the hatlock) to avoid creating
10871 * the HAT_ISMBUSY flag set, which in turn could block other kernel
10882 while (S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Y))
10884 SFMMU_FLAGS_SET(sfmmup, HAT_ISMBUSY);
10896 ASSERT(S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Y));
10897 SFMMU_FLAGS_CLEAR(sfmmup, HAT_ISMBUSY);
11838 if (S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Y)) {
12109 !S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Y)) {
15014 ASSERT(!S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Y));
15148 S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Y));
15158 while (S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Y) &&
15168 SFMMU_FLAGS_SET(sfmmup, HAT_ISMBUSY);
15187 ASSERT(SFMMU_FLAGS_ISSET(sfmmup, HAT_ISMBUSY));
15208 SFMMU_FLAGS_CLEAR(sfmmup, HAT_ISMBUSY);
15315 * Note that the caller either set HAT_ISMBUSY flag or checked
15316 * under hat lock that HAT_ISMBUSY was not set by another thread.